**Putative father**

A *putative father* refers to a man who is alleged or assumed to be the biological father of a child, but whose paternity has not yet been legally established or confirmed. This term is often used in family law, particularly in cases involving child custody, support, and inheritance rights. Understanding the role and rights of a putative father is essential in legal proceedings to ensure the welfare of the child and the proper determination of parental responsibilities.
